Any zombie can dance to Michael Jackson’s “Thriller,” right? Some of us non-corpses, though, never quite got through the first three steps without wishing we were dead. But thanks to this fantastic t-shirt, which Threadless reprinted in MJ’s memory, we might just have a chance after all.

Thriller Zombie Shirt on Threadless

Illustrated zombies depict the dance broken down in 12 “frames” in this stylish and user-friendly t-shirt. What more could you want in casual zombie apparel?

We spotted some beautiful zombie tattoos on Flickr today, which turned out to be the work of Stefano Alcantara, a US-based Peruvian artist who does amazing fantasy and photorealistic tattoo work.

Angelina Jolie Zombie Tatoo

zombie tatoo

These photos were probably posted to promote Alcantara’s recent guest appearance at the Last Rites Tattoo Theater in New York City, which looks like a dark fantasy mecca.

Rick Murray, AKA Zombie Boy, is transforming his body into the living dead. He looks pretty badass.

Rick Murray, Zombie Boy (Tattoos)

Murray was inspired by horror movies, especially George A Romero’s films. In an interview with Bizarre magazine, he explains his motivation. “I thought long and hard about what I really wanted, what my passion was. And I decided I wanted to be a fucking zombie.”

He’s really lucid about his ongoing tattoo project — which may eventually include tattooing the whites of his eyes and removing an ear — and overall, sounds like a pretty cool guy. Check out the article in Bizarre for the full interview and lots more photos.

Besides Zombie Horse, here’s another reason why Denver is a hotspot for the living dead: next weekend’s Sexy Zombie Fashion Show.

Models will walk the runway in torn, blood-splattered apparel, zombie art will be displayed and created, and live bands will rock your brains out. Sounds like a blast!

If you’re in Denver (and sadly, I’m not!) you can respond to the casting call and check out the March 7th show at the Fashion Zombies website.
